Port Olbia
Welcome to Sardinia! Olbia is a beautiful port city with medieval basilica and beautiful squares. The promenade is lined with palm trees and invites you to stroll. North of the centre, the remains of a Roman aqueduct can be visited. Just outside, two archaeological sights await visitors: a giant’s tomb from the Bronze Age and the ruins of the medieval Castello Pedres. From there, you can enjoy a wonderful view of the city and harbor.

Ferry connections from & to Olbia
Here you see an overview of all ferry routes which currently call at the port of Olbia:
| Route | Country of origin & country of destination | Number & Duration |
|---|---|---|
| Ferry Civitavecchia – Olbia | Rome, ItalySardinia | up to 8 times a day 7 hours |
| Ferry Genoa – Olbia | ItalySardinia | up to 4 times a day 11 hours |
| Ferries Livorno – Olbia (Sardinia) | ItalySardinia | up to 4 times a day 7 hours 30 minutes |
| Ferry Piombino – Olbia | ItalySardinia, Italy | up to 6 times a week 5 hours 30 minutes |

Travel information
Arrival by car
- From the direction of Cagliari (south): Ferry north on the SS131 to the Olbia exit. Follow the SS199 and the signs to the port of Olbia.
- From the direction of Sassari (northwest): Take the SS597 and then the SS729 towards Olbia. Follow the signs to the harbor.
- From the direction of Nuoro (west): Ferries on the SS131DCN to the Olbia exit and then follow the SS199 to the harbor.
Arrival by bus and train
- Olbia is easily accessible by bus and train. The main lines connect Olbia with Cagliari, Sassari and other cities in Sardinia.
- Olbia’s train and bus stations are not far from the port. From there, you can walk or take a local cab to the port.
Arrival by plane
- Olbia Costa Smeralda Airport (OLB): This airport is located near Olbia. From there, you can take a cab or hire a car to get to the port. There are also bus services connecting the airport with the port.
Travel guide: Olbia – The gateway to Sardinia’s wonders
Explore Olbia, a lively port city on the north-eastern coast of Sardinia. Known for its rich history, beautiful beaches and lively atmosphere, Olbia is the perfect starting point to discover the beauty of Sardinia.
Sights and excursion destinations
- Archaeological Museum of Olbia: Immerse yourself in Sardinia’s past with fascinating finds from the Nuragic period.
- Basilica of San Simplicio: An impressive Romanesque church from the 11th century that bears witness to a rich history.
- Corso Umberto: The lively main street, ideal for a stroll and discovering local stores.
- Cala Brandinchi: A dreamlike beach, known as “little Tahiti”, with crystal-clear water and fine sand.
